RED BAY, AL – Kelly Joe Moore, 71, passed away Monday, January 8, 2024 at UAB Hospital, Birmingham, AL. He was born in Russellville, AL to Richmond and Magdelene Moore. Kelly lived his life serving others. His career spanned sales, customer service and banking. He was known as Pops by his family as well as all the friends of his grandchildren and JoJo by all his golfing buddies at Redmont Country Club. Kelly  accepted Jesus as a young boy and was a charter member of Grace Methodist Church in Red Bay. He has been an active member of the Alabama Walk to Emmaus Community since 1999 where he lived out Matthew 20:28, “to serve, not to be served”. As a lay director, Kelly’s theme verse was “With God All Things Are Possible,” Matthew 19:26, words he believed with his whole heart.

Kelly was an avid Bama fan traveling nationwide from the Aloha Bowl in Honolulu to Penn State and to the Orange Bowl in Florida. For many years, if Bama was playing – Kelly was there. He was also a strong supporter of the Red Bay Tigers, remembered by many of his ringing “Touchdown Tigers!” as he assisted Jack Ivy with football broadcasts. Kelly had a lifelong passion for rv travel and cruising. He and his wife, Sally have visited almost every state and several foreign countries exploring our beautiful world. He saw beauty in nature and loved touring the national parks.

Visitation will be Wednesday, January 10, 6-8 p.m. at Deaton Funeral Home, Red Bay, AL. Funeral services will be Thursday, January 11, 11 a.m. at Grace Methodist Church, 627 10th St. SE, Red Bay, AL with Bro. Eric Brown and Bro. Elliott Gordon officiating. He will lie in state at the church on Thursday from 10-11 a.m. Burial will be in the Red Bay City Cemetery. Deaton Funeral Home, Red Bay, AL will be in charge of arrangements.

Left to mourn him is his wife of fifty years, Sally Moore; a daughter, Shanna Moore Ozbirn and her fiancé, Randy Sanderson; granddaughters, Keylee Moore Allison (Trevor) of Russellville and Kyndell Ozbirn of Red Bay; his namesake, great-grandson, Travis Kelly Allison of Russellville, AL and one brother, Carlton Moore (Becky) of Decatur.

Pallbearers will be Hal Keeton, Keith Kennedy, Harold Ledbetter, Mike Kennedy, Alan Bostick and Brooks Davis. Honorary pallbearers will be the CB&S Coffee Club and his Redmont Country Club golf buddies.

In lieu of flowers, the family requests that memorials be made to the Grace Methodist Church Building Fund, P.O. Box 1397, Red Bay, AL 35582.
